你查询的IP:[159.226.102.205]  地理位置:中国–北京–北京科技网

最新查询116.208.106.189 116.248.149.161 123.138.213.119 119.176.189.110 125.215.196.183 220.248.130.157 122.206.128.193 221.169.245.225 161.207.182.137 159.226.102.205 210.87.128.201 123.253.223.173 122.201.128.73 220.231.52.153 222.192.54.53 202.127.157.96 124.112.205.56 117.24.125.82 123.253.173.61 122.112.164.41 202.60.112.17 119.20.69.14 114.54.141.15 202.122.112.35 121.52.160.45 116.214.64.253 202.143.16.108 202.143.16.84 202.4.128.175 210.32.8.63 116.89.144.198